The Role of AI in Personal Branding

AI has revolutionized the way we interact with technology and has become an integral part of our daily lives. From voice assistants like Siri and Alexa to recommendation algorithms on social media platforms, AI is constantly shaping our online experiences. When it comes to personal branding, AI can play a significant role in both positive and negative ways.

Positive Impact of AI on Personal Branding

AI can be a powerful tool for personal branding, helping individuals reach a wider audience and enhance their online presence. Here are a few ways AI can have a positive impact:

  • Content Creation: AI-powered tools can assist individuals in creating high-quality content, such as blog posts, social media updates, or even videos. These tools can analyze data, identify trends, and generate personalized content that resonates with the target audience.
  • Personalized Recommendations: AI algorithms can analyze user behavior and preferences to provide personalized recommendations to individuals. This can help individuals curate their online presence by sharing relevant content and engaging with their audience more effectively.
  • Automation: AI can automate repetitive tasks, such as scheduling social media posts or responding to common inquiries. This allows individuals to focus on more strategic aspects of personal branding, such as creating valuable content and building relationships with their audience.

Negative Impact of AI on Personal Branding

While AI offers numerous benefits, it also poses some challenges for personal branding. Here are a few potential negative impacts:

  • Loss of Authenticity: AI-generated content may lack the personal touch and authenticity that is crucial for building a strong personal brand. It is important for individuals to strike a balance between leveraging AI tools and maintaining their unique voice and perspective.
  • Privacy Concerns: AI algorithms rely on data to provide personalized recommendations and insights. However, this raises concerns about privacy and data security. Individuals need to be cautious about the information they share online and ensure they are comfortable with the data being used to shape their personal brand.
  • Algorithmic Bias: AI algorithms are not immune to biases. They can inadvertently perpetuate stereotypes or favor certain types of content or individuals. It is essential for individuals to be aware of these biases and actively work towards creating a diverse and inclusive personal brand.

Crafting an Authentic Online Identity

While AI can be a valuable tool, it is essential for individuals to maintain authenticity and create a genuine online identity. Here are some strategies to craft an authentic online identity:

Define Your Personal Brand

Before diving into the digital world, it is crucial to define your personal brand. Start by identifying your values, passions, and expertise. What sets you apart from others in your field? What do you want to be known for? Understanding your personal brand will help you shape your online identity in a way that aligns with your goals and values.

Be Consistent Across Platforms

Consistency is key when it comes to personal branding. Ensure that your online presence is consistent across different platforms. Use the same profile picture, handle, and bio to create a cohesive brand image. Consistency helps build recognition and trust among your audience.

Showcase Your Expertise

One of the most effective ways to establish your personal brand is by showcasing your expertise. Share valuable insights, industry trends, and thought-provoking content that demonstrates your knowledge and experience. This can be done through blog posts, social media updates, or even participating in online communities and discussions.

Engage with Your Audience

Building a personal brand is not just about broadcasting your message; it is also about engaging with your audience. Respond to comments, answer questions, and participate in conversations related to your field. This helps build relationships and establishes you as an approachable and knowledgeable authority in your industry.

Be Authentic and Transparent

Avoid the temptation to create a persona that is not true to who you are. Authenticity is crucial for building trust and credibility. Be transparent about your values, experiences, and even your failures. People appreciate honesty and are more likely to connect with someone who is genuine.
